A GC-friendly #golang interning cache.

> This change will be in Go 1.20 and it has zero exposed APIs: you just upgrade Go and every application that opens multiple TLS connections will be automagically a little lighter and faster. ✨

The runtime now has experimental support for memory-safe arena allocation that makes it possible to eagerly free memory in bulk. It has the potential to improve CPU performance by up to 15% in memory-allocation-heavy applications. (c)
